A good friend of mine was luck enough to draw a goat tag in Idaho this year. Lucky for him our elk hunting partner KP knows the area he drew well from drawing the tag a few years back and was able to head up in the high mountains to help him find this Billy.
KP's story:
After the long week in New Mexico, this weekend was another success with the find of this nice Billy. We got him late Sunday afternoon and had to pack him out yesterday. We hunted for around a total of 10 days and probably saw around 20 goats, most of which were nannies and small billys. We finally found this guy sitting by himself in a trench that he dug out relaxing in the sun.
There were no rock cliffs and fairly easy access. We watched the guy for about 40 minutes from two hundred yards before we let him stand up for the last time.
